    High NO (PPM)

    so i went to do my smog test and it failed due high no, my readings were...
    15 mph MAX: 825 AVE: 356 MEAS:1349
    25 mph MAX:764 AVE: 300 MEAS:1264
    what can i do to lower the NO???

    Re: High NO (PPM)

    Well first make sure the temp is well in the warm zone. you can run injector cleaner through it to get it to run better. Also replacing spark plugs and making sure they are gaped right with lower your n0.

    This is a good start, you might want to also make sure your EGR valve is cleaned properly.
